We are looking for an organised and proactive HR Officer to support the day-to-day people operations of our growing business.

This role will play a key part in delivering a smooth employee experience across the full HR lifecycle, including onboarding, employee relations, HR administration, and policy implementation. You will work closely with management and employees to ensure HR processes are effective, compliant, and aligned with the needs of the business.

  • Support end-to-end employee lifecycle activities, including onboarding, probation, role changes, and offboarding.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date employee records, contracts, and HR documentation.
  • Act as a first point of contact for employee HR queries, providing clear and practical guidance.
  • Support the implementation and communication of HR policies, procedures, and best practices.
  • Assist with employee relations matters, including absence management, performance processes, and disciplinary procedures.
  • Coordinate recruitment administration, including interview scheduling and offer documentation, as required.
  • Support payroll, benefits administration, and HR reporting in collaboration with finance and external providers.
  • Ensure HR practices comply with UK employment law and internal governance requirements.

Requirements:

  • 1–3 years’ experience in an HR Officer, HR Administrator, or similar people operations role.
  • Solid understanding of UK employment law and HR best practices.
  • Strong organisational skills with att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ple priorities.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• High level of professionalism, discretion, and confidentiality.
  • Ability to work effectively with employees and managers across different teams.
